Key Metric Definitions
Annual dividend per share divided by current share price.
Percentage of earnings paid as dividends. Below 60% = safe, above 100% = unsustainable.
Percentage of Free Cash Flow paid as dividends. More reliable than Payout Ratio since it measures actual cash.
Compound annual growth rate of dividends over the last 5 years.
Reliability of dividend payments over lifetime. Penalizes cuts and pauses.
Your effective yield if you bought 5 years ago. Shows dividend growth impact over time.
Consecutive years of dividend payments. 25+ years = Dividend Aristocrat.
Proprietary score (0-100) combining yield, growth, safety and consistency.
